Last week, the Reparations Task Force in California, a state where slavery was never legal, just released its final 1,100-page report, which includes more than 100 policy recommendations.
THE SUPREME COURT SAVED THE CONSTITUTION FROM BIDENFirst, while the report does not give a specific dollar amount that should be paid, CNN reported that it used a formula that concludes each eligible resident may be owed up to $1.2 million. The report emphasizes that the final estimates are “conservative.” But, then again, so did those who made proposals for payment of up to $5 million per resident. I’d like to see what an upper-end estimate looks like according to the task force.
Yet that is still just the beginning. The report recommended that the state abolish the death penalty, make Election Day a national holiday, do a systematic review of school discipline data in order to disrupt the “school-to-prison pipeline,” and eliminate all “back child support debt.” Additionally, it calls to “eliminate disparities” — the word “disparities” was used 450 times in the report — in domains such as STEM, prisons, and education. But how exactly those disparities ought to be “eliminated” is largely left unclear.
